Background technology
Pulverizer is the machinery that large-sized solid material is crushed to desired size.Pulverizer is by coarse crushing, fine crushing and wind
The devices composition such as power conveying, the purpose of pulverizer is reached in the form of high-speed impact, using wind energy once at powder, eliminates tradition
Screening sequence, mine is mainly applied, in a variety of industries such as building materials.
The principle of pulverizer is exactly to realize that the general of dryness material crushes using the shock of Disintegrating knife high speed rotation, it
It is made of pulverizing chamber, Disintegrating knife and high-speed electric expreess locomotive etc., and cutting tool is easy damage after pulverizer longevity of service, and
Cutting tool on common pulverizer is all directly to be fixedly mounted on roller, it has not been convenient to be replaced.

When work, the second nut 23 is unscrewed, fixed screw 22 is taken out, crushing chamber 5 is removed, then by 16 He of the first belt
Second belt 19 is removed, it would be desirable to which the Disintegrating knife 11 of replacement is rotated to the top of pulverization roller 9, unscrews the first nut 14, is taken out
Fixed link 13, then the blade needed replacing is taken out and is replaced.
